Jim Garrison is a scholar working on Philosophy, Education and Sociology and Political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Jim Garrison has authored 89 papers receiving a total of 1.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 50 papers in Philosophy, 49 papers in Education and 11 papers in Sociology and Political Science. Recurrent topics in Jim Garrison’s work include Pragmatism in Philosophy and Education (46 papers), Education and Critical Thinking Development (31 papers) and Wittgensteinian philosophy and applications (13 papers). Jim Garrison is often cited by papers focused on Pragmatism in Philosophy and Education (46 papers), Education and Critical Thinking Development (31 papers) and Wittgensteinian philosophy and applications (13 papers). Jim Garrison collaborates with scholars based in United States, Sweden and Germany. Jim Garrison's co-authors include Leif Östman, Daniel P. Liston, Marie Larochelle, Shabnam Mousavi, Jacques Désautels, Stefan Neubert, Kersten Reich, Marie Öhman, A. G. Rud and Michael L. Bentley and has published in prestigious journals such as American Educational Research Journal, Educational Researcher and Science Education.
